How do you remove the ball joint & outer tie rod end?
I got the whole front suspension off to replace all of the bad joint that's making all the squeal & noises when i drive.
I don't know how to go about getting the ball joint and the outer tie rod end off. do i just hammer the ball joint till it pop out? the outer tie rod end, i have to turn it clockwise to losen it so i can remove it right?

First thing you should do is get a careful measurement from somewhere fixed on the subframe to the center of the outer ball joint stud while the steering wheel is level and locked... Remove the saftey cotter pin. Then back off the nut on the ball joint stud, then smack the side of the ball joint with a big hammer; go ahead HIT IT quit swinging the hammer like a girl and HIT IT LOL Then when it pops loose you should be able to break loose the locking nut on the tie rod and unscrew the ball joint...try to get the new joint screwed back on so your prior measurement is very close, I'd still recommend an alignment after the job is done to be sure the Toe is correct....but the measure method will allow the car to be drivable.
